Tips to Avoid Scams Like Theshinybrand.Com Scam

Stay vigilant and do your research when shopping online to protect yourself from potential scams. To avoid falling victim to scams, here are some tips to help you spot fake online reviews and verify the legitimacy of an e-commerce website:

Look for patterns in reviews: If you notice multiple reviews with similar wording or excessive positive feedback, it could be a sign of fake reviews. Genuine reviews are usually diverse in content and tone.

Check the reviewer’s profile: Take a closer look at the reviewer’s history and activity. If they have only reviewed one product or have a suspiciously high number of positive reviews, it may indicate fake accounts.

Cross-reference reviews: Compare reviews on different platforms or websites. If you find contradicting information or drastically different ratings, it’s worth questioning the authenticity of the reviews.

To verify the legitimacy of an e-commerce website:

Look for contact information: Legitimate websites will provide clear contact information, including a physical address and a customer service phone number or email.

Check for SSL security: Look for the padlock symbol in the website’s URL. This indicates that the site has an SSL certificate and encrypts your data, providing a safer browsing experience.

Research the website’s reputation: Read reviews from reputable sources or online forums to get insights from other customers. Look for any red flags or warnings about the website’s trustworthiness.

By following these steps, you can minimize the risk of falling for online scams and make informed decisions when shopping online. Remember, being proactive and cautious is key to protecting your freedom and financial well-being.

Theshinybrand.Com Scam Warning signs

When shopping online, it’s important to be aware of the warning signs that indicate a potential scam. Be cautious of websites that exhibit suspicious characteristics and lack credibility. Look out for websites that offer huge discounts that seem too good to be true.

Also, watch for websites that use new domains or private registrations. Another warning sign is relying on stock photos instead of original product images.

Furthermore, be wary of websites that lack reviews or testimonials from previous customers. Lastly, be cautious of websites that request unnecessary personal information.
